To make tired eyes look perky: On days when your eyes are bloodshot and tired, trade in your black mascara for a navy one. Blue creates less of contrast than black, so the red will be less obvious. We like Maybelline Great Lash Mascara in Royal Blue, $6.16.

To make eyes look bigger: Use lighter shade of liner on your bottom lash line than you use on your upper lash line. (For example, use black top and gray on bottom.) Try Max Factor PenSilks Soft Charcoal, $5.82, and Delux Beauty Eyeliner in Nila Black, $12. Encircling your eye entirely with a dark hue makes it look smaller. Curl your top lashes to open your eyes even more. A cool curling mascara: Estee Lauder Illusionist Maximum Curling Mascara in Black, $19.50.

To make dull hair look shiny: Use a silicone spray to up your mane's reflection factor. Spritz it on your brush, then whisk it lightly along your hair to avoid product overload. Try Redken Vinyl Glam Mega Shine Spray, $13.95.

To make your hair look thicker: Sprinkle a bit of baby powder on your roots (pour it in your palm first so you don't OD), use a paddle brush to tease hair section by section, then smooth roots with a comb.

To make cleavage look deeper: Lightly dust bronzing powder between your breasts to accentuate the depth of your divide. Then sweep a lighter shimmer powder over your breasts and collarbone to make your ta-tas look extra round and tantalizing.

To make your legs look thinner: Mix bronze shimmer powder with moisturizer, then slather it on your legs to make them look instantly more toned and obscure any flaws.
